LVN | LPT
Job Duties
- Provides direct nursing care to the clients according to physicians’ orders and applicable client care standards, within their scope of practice.
- Provides direction to non-licensed personnel in providing direct client care and operating the unit.
Qualifications
- Current licensure in California as an LVN or LPT.
- Knowledge of general nursing theory and practice.
- Ability to supervise.
- Ability to work cooperatively with other staff members.
- Previous experience in mental health nursing preferred.
- Current CPR and first aid certifications.
